Linux für alte 32-Bit-Rechner – Kompatibilitätsrechner
Finden Sie die optimale Linux-Distribution für Ihren alten 32-Bit-PC basierend auf Hardware-Spezifikationen und Anwendungsbedarf.
Umfassender Leitfaden: Linux für alte 32-Bit-Rechner (2024)
Warum Linux die beste Wahl für alte 32-Bit-PCs ist
Mit dem Ende der Unterstützung für Windows XP im Jahr 2014 und der zunehmenden Ressourcenintensivität moderner Betriebssysteme stehen Besitzer älterer 32-Bit-Rechner vor einer Herausforderung. Linux bietet hier eine ideale Lösung durch:
- Geringe Systemanforderungen: Viele Distributionen laufen mit ≤ 256 MB RAM und Prozessoren unter 1 GHz
- Langfristige Sicherheit: Aktive Community-Unterstützung und regelmäßige Updates für viele Distributionen
- 32-Bit-Kompatibilität: Spezielle Distributionen, die explizit 32-Bit-Architekturen unterstützen
- Modularität: Möglichkeit, nur die benötigten Komponenten zu installieren
- Kostenlos: Keine Lizenzgebühren oder veraltete Software-Probleme
Laut einer Studie des NIST (National Institute of Standards and Technology) können gut konfigurierte Linux-Systeme auf alter Hardware eine 3-5 mal längere Nutzungsdauer ermöglichen als proprietäre Systeme.
Technische Voraussetzungen für Linux auf 32-Bit-Systemen
Hardware-Anforderungen im Detail
| Komponente | Minimalanforderung | Empfohlene Spezifikation | Hinweise |
|---|---|---|---|
| Prozessor | i586 (Pentium klassisch) | i686 (Pentium II oder neuer) | PAE-Unterstützung ermöglicht >4GB RAM-Nutzung |
| Arbeitsspeicher | 64 MB (Textmodus) | 512 MB (grafische Oberfläche) | 1 GB ermöglicht komfortables Arbeiten |
| Festplatte | 2 GB | 10 GB | SSDs beschleunigen alte Systeme deutlich |
| Grafikkarte | VGA (640×480) | SVGA (1024×768) | Moderne Treiber oft nicht verfügbar |
Wichtige 32-Bit-spezifische Überlegungen
- PAE-Kernel: Ermöglicht die Nutzung von mehr als 4GB RAM auf 32-Bit-Systemen (Physical Address Extension)
- Legacy-BIOS: Die meisten alten Systeme verwenden BIOS statt UEFI – dies beeinflusst die Installationsmethode
- Treiberverfügbarkeit: Proprietäre Treiber (z.B. für WLAN-Karten) sind oft nicht mehr verfügbar
- SMP-Unterstützung: Symmetrisches Multiprocessing für Mehrkern-Prozessoren muss explizit aktiviert sein
- Dateisysteme: ext4 ist die beste Wahl für alte Hardware (besser als NTFS oder FAT32)
Top 10 Linux-Distributionen für 32-Bit-Rechner (2024)
1. AntiX Linux
Beste Gesamtleistung
- Basiert auf Debian Stable mit speziellen Optimierungen für alte Hardware
- Läuft mit nur 256 MB RAM und i486-Prozessoren
- Eigener “AntiX Magic”-Toolkit für Hardware-Konfiguration
- Vier verschiedene Window-Manager zur Auswahl
- Aktive 32-Bit-Unterstützung bis mindestens 2027
2. Q4OS
Beste Windows-Ähnlichkeit
- Trinity Desktop Environment (TDE) als Standard – sehr ressourcenschonend
- Kann auch mit KDE Plasma laufen (ab 1GB RAM)
- Einfache Installation von Debian-Paketen
- Spezielle “Plasma Mobile”-Version für Touchscreens
3. Puppy Linux
Beste für extrem alte Hardware
- Läuft komplett im RAM (ab 300 MB)
- Schnellster Bootvorgang aller Distributionen
- Eigene “Puppy”-Anwendungen für maximale Effizienz
- Keine traditionelle Installation nötig – läuft von USB/CD
4. Debian 32-bit
Beste Langzeitunterstützung
- Offizielle 32-Bit-Version mit 5 Jahren Support
- Über 59.000 Pakete verfügbar
- Kann auf nur 1GB Festplattenspeicher installiert werden
- Stabile Basis für Server-Anwendungen
5. Bodhi Linux
Beste für moderne Oberflächen
- Verwendet Moksha Desktop (Fork von Enlightenment 17)
- Extrem ressourcenschonend bei modernem Look
- Ubuntu-LTS-basiert mit Langzeitunterstützung
- AppCenter für einfache Softwareinstallation
Vergleichstabelle der Top 5 Distributionen
| Distribution | Min. RAM | Min. CPU | Installationsgröße | Desktop-Umgebung | Besonderheiten |
|---|---|---|---|---|---|
| AntiX | 128 MB | i486 | 3 GB | IceWM, Fluxbox, JWM, Herald | PAE-Kernel standardmäßig, eigene Systemtools |
| Q4OS | 256 MB | i686 | 3.5 GB | Trinity (TDE), KDE Plasma | Windows-XP-ähnliches Erscheinungsbild |
| Puppy Linux | 64 MB | i486 | 300 MB | JWM, Openbox | Läuft komplett im RAM, persistente Speicherung |
| Debian | 512 MB | i686 | 2 GB | GNOME, Xfce, LXDE, LXQt | Größtes Software-Repository, 5 Jahre Support |
| Bodhi | 256 MB | i686 | 4 GB | Moksha | Ubuntu-basiert, extrem schnelle Oberfläche |
Schritt-für-Schritt-Anleitung: Linux auf einem 32-Bit-Rechner installieren
1. Vorbereitung der Installation
- Hardware-Inventur: Notieren Sie sich alle Komponenten (CPU, RAM, Grafikkarte, Netzwerkadapter)
- Daten sichern: Alle wichtigen Dateien auf externe Medien kopieren
- Installationsmedium erstellen:
- Für CDs: Brennen Sie das ISO mit langsamer Geschwindigkeit (4x)
- Für USB-Sticks: Verwenden Sie
ddoder Rufus im “DD-Modus”
- BIOS-Einstellungen prüfen:
- Boot-Reihenfolge anpassen (CD/USB zuerst)
- ACPI-Einstellungen auf “S1” setzen (für bessere Energieverwaltung)
- Deaktivieren Sie “Quick Boot” oder “Fast Boot”
2. Installation durchführen
- Booten vom Installationsmedium: Wählen Sie ggf. “Safe Graphics Mode” bei Grafikproblemen
- Sprach- und Tastatureinstellungen: Wählen Sie Ihre Locale (z.B. “de_DE.UTF-8”)
- Partitionierung:
- Für Anfänger: Automatische Partitionierung wählen
- Für Fortgeschrittene:
- / (root): ext4, 10-20 GB
- /home: ext4, restlicher Platz
- swap: 1-2x RAM-Größe (max. 2 GB)
- Benutzer einrichten: Verwenden Sie ein sicheres Passwort (mind. 12 Zeichen)
- Paketauswahl:
- Für ≤ 512 MB RAM: Nur “Standard-Systemtools” wählen
- Für 1 GB+ RAM: Grafische Oberfläche (z.B. Xfce) hinzufügen
- Bootloader installieren: GRUB auf die MBR der Festplatte (z.B. /dev/sda)
3. Nach der Installation
- System aktualisieren:
sudo apt update && sudo apt upgrade -y
- Treiber installieren:
- Grafik:
sudo apt install xserver-xorg-video-all - WLAN:
sudo apt install firmware-linux firmware-realtek
- Grafik:
- Leistungsoptimierungen:
- Deaktivieren Sie unnötige Dienste:
sudo systemctl disable --now avahi-daemon cups-browsed - Aktivieren Sie zswap für besseres RAM-Management:
echo "vm.swappiness=10 vm.vfs_cache_pressure=50 vm.watermark_scale_factor=200" | sudo tee -a /etc/sysctl.conf
- Verwenden Sie preload für häufig genutzte Anwendungen:
sudo apt install preload
- Deaktivieren Sie unnötige Dienste:
- Empfohlene Anwendungen:
Kategorie Empfohlene Anwendung RAM-Verbrauch Office AbiWord + Gnumeric ~150 MB Browser Firefox ESR oder Falkon ~200-300 MB Medienplayer mpv oder VLC (ohne Qt-Oberfläche) ~50-100 MB Bildbearbeitung GIMP (mit reduzierten Plug-ins) ~250 MB
Leistungsoptimierung für 32-Bit-Linux-Systeme
Kernel-Optimierungen
- Low-Latency-Kernel: Für Echtzeit-Anwendungen (Audio, Video)
sudo apt install linux-image-lowlatency
- PAE-Kernel: Für Systeme mit >4GB RAM
sudo apt install linux-image-686-pae
- Echtzeit-Patches: Für professionelle Audioarbeit (nur für Fortgeschrittene)
Dateisystem-Optimierungen
- Mount-Optionen für ext4:
UUID=... / ext4 noatime,nodiratime,data=writeback,commit=60 0 1
- Swap-Einstellungen:
- Swappiness auf 10 reduzieren:
vm.swappiness=10 - ZRAM/SWAP-Priorität anpassen:
zram.swap-priority=100
- Swappiness auf 10 reduzieren:
- TMPFS nutzen: Für temporäre Dateien im RAM
tmpfs /tmp tmpfs defaults,noatime,mode=1777,size=512M 0 0
Grafikperformance verbessern
- Compositing deaktivieren: Für Window-Manager wie Openbox oder IceWM
- Leichtere Themen verwenden: z.B. “Adwaita” statt “Ambience”
- Hardware-Beschleunigung prüfen:
glxinfo | grep "direct rendering"
Falls “no” angezeigt wird:sudo apt install mesa-utils libgl1-mesa-dri - Framebuffer-Treiber: Für Systeme ohne X11-Unterstützung:
sudo apt install fbset fbi
Netzwerkoptimierungen
- DNS-Caching:
sudo apt install dnsmasq-base
- Bandbreitenmanagement:
sudo apt install wondershaper
- IPv6 deaktivieren (falls nicht benötigt):
echo "net.ipv6.conf.all.disable_ipv6=1 net.ipv6.conf.default.disable_ipv6=1" | sudo tee -a /etc/sysctl.conf
Häufige Probleme und Lösungen
1. Grafikprobleme (schwarzer Bildschirm, Artefakte)
- Ursache: Fehlende oder inkompatible Grafiktreiber
- Lösungen:
- Boot-Parameter anpassen:
nomodesetoderxforcevesa - Framebuffer-Treiber installieren:
sudo apt install xserver-xorg-video-fbdev - Manuell Xorg konfigurieren:
Section "Device" Identifier "Configured Video Device" Driver "vesa" EndSection - Für NVIDIA-Karten: Legacy-Treiber (304xx oder 340xx Serie)
- Boot-Parameter anpassen:
2. Langsame Systemperformance
- Ursachen:
- Zu viele Hintergrunddienste
- Unoptimierte Swap-Einstellungen
- Fragmentierte Festplatte
- Veraltete Bibliotheken
- Diagnose-Tools:
top # Prozesse anzeigen free -h # Speichernutzung vmstat 1 # Systemaktivität iotop # Festplatten-I/O
- Lösungen:
- Unnötige Dienste deaktivieren:
sudo systemctl list-units --type=service - ZRAM aktivieren:
sudo apt install zram-config - Festplatte defragmentieren (nur für ext4 mit
e4defrag) - Alte Kernel entfernen:
sudo apt autoremove --purge
- Unnötige Dienste deaktivieren:
3. WLAN/Netzwerk Probleme
- Häufige Ursachen:
- Fehlende Firmware für WLAN-Karten
- Veraltete Treiber für Ethernet-Controller
- Falsche Netzwerkkonfiguration
- Lösungsansätze:
- Firmware-Pakete installieren:
sudo apt install firmware-iwlwifi firmware-realtek firmware-atheros
- Netzwerk-Manager neu starten:
sudo systemctl restart NetworkManager
- Manuelle Konfiguration in
/etc/network/interfaces - Für Broadcom-Karten:
sudo apt install b43-fwcutter - USB-WLAN-Adapter mit Ralink-Chipsatz (RT5370) verwenden
- Firmware-Pakete installieren:
4. Soundprobleme
- Diagnose:
aplay -l # Soundkarten auflisten alsamixer # Lautstärke einstellen pactl list # PulseAudio-Informationen
- Lösungen:
- ALSA neu initialisieren:
sudo alsa force-reload - PulseAudio deaktivieren (falls nicht benötigt):
sudo apt purge pulseaudio
- OSS-Emulation aktivieren:
sudo modprobe snd-pcm-oss sudo modprobe snd-mixer-oss
- Für ältere Soundkarten:
sudo apt install oss-compat
- ALSA neu initialisieren:
Sicherheitsaspekte für 32-Bit-Linux-Systeme
Laut einer Studie des US-CERT sind ältere 32-Bit-Systeme besonders anfällig für:
- Speicherkorruptionsangriffe (Buffer Overflows)
- Side-Channel-Angriffe (Spectre, Meltdown)
- Veraltete Krypto-Algorithmen (SSLv3, DES)
- Fehlende Address Space Layout Randomization (ASLR)
Essentielle Sicherheitsmaßnahmen
- Kernel-Härtung:
echo "kernel.kptr_restrict=2 kernel.dmesg_restrict=1 kernel.unprivileged_bpf_disabled=1" | sudo tee -a /etc/sysctl.conf
- Firewall-Konfiguration:
sudo apt install ufw sudo ufw default deny incoming sudo ufw default allow outgoing sudo ufw enable
- Automatische Updates:
sudo apt install unattended-upgrades sudo dpkg-reconfigure unattended-upgrades
- Sandboxing:
- Firejail für Anwendungen:
sudo apt install firejail - AppArmor aktivieren:
sudo aa-enforce /etc/apparmor.d/*
- Firejail für Anwendungen:
- Sichere Browser-Konfiguration:
- JavaScript deaktivieren (oder NoScript verwenden)
- WebRTC deaktivieren (Datenschutz)
- HTTPS Everywhere installieren
- User-Agent spoofen (z.B. mit “Random Agent Spoofer”)
Empfohlene Sicherheits-Tools
| Tool | Zweck | Installation | RAM-Verbrauch |
|---|---|---|---|
| rkhunter | Rootkit-Erkennung | sudo apt install rkhunter |
~50 MB |
| lynis | System-Audit | sudo apt install lynis |
~30 MB |
| clamscan | Viren Scanner | sudo apt install clamav |
~100 MB |
| fail2ban | Brute-Force-Schutz | sudo apt install fail2ban |
~20 MB |
| apparmor | Anwendungs-Sandboxing | Vorinstalliert (aktivieren) | ~10 MB |
Zukunftsperspektiven: Wie lange werden 32-Bit-Systeme noch unterstützt?
Die Unterstützung für 32-Bit-Systeme nimmt kontinuierlich ab. Laut einer Offiziellen Debian-Ankündigung werden die wichtigsten Meilensteine sein:
Zeitplan für 32-Bit-Unterstützung
| Jahr | Ereignis | Auswirkungen |
|---|---|---|
| 2024 | Debian 12 “Bookworm” | Volle 32-Bit-Unterstützung, aber ohne non-PAE-Kernel |
| 2025 | Ubuntu 24.04 LTS | Keine offiziellen 32-Bit-ISOs mehr, aber Community-Ports |
| 2026 | Debian 13 | Wahrscheinlich letzte Version mit 32-Bit-Unterstützung |
| 2027 | Ende der Debian-32-Bit-Ports | Nur noch Community-Distributionen wie AntiX |
| 2030+ | Komplettes Ende | Keine Sicherheitsupdates mehr für 32-Bit |
Langfristige Alternativen
- Emulation:
- QEMU mit KVM-Beschleunigung für 32-Bit-Gäste
- Docker-Container mit 32-Bit-Bibliotheken
- Hardware-Upgrades:
- Gebrauchte 64-Bit-Systeme (ab ~20€)
- Raspberry Pi (ARM-Architektur, aber gute 32-Bit-Unterstützung)
- Retro-Computing-Communities:
- Spezialisierte Distributionen wie “Damn Small Linux”
- Foren wie Vintage Computer Federation
Fazit: Lohnt sich Linux auf 32-Bit-Rechnern noch?
Die Antwort ist ein klares Ja, aber mit wichtigen Einschränkungen:
Vorteile:
- Kostenlose Nutzung ohne Lizenzprobleme
- Sicherere Alternative zu veralteten Windows-Versionen
- Modularität ermöglicht maßgeschneiderte Systeme
- Gute Community-Unterstützung für spezifische Hardware
- Ideal für Lernzwecke (Systemadministration, Netzwerke)
Nachteile:
- Abnehmende Software-Unterstützung (z.B. keine modernen Browser)
- Sicherheitsrisiken durch fehlende Hardware-Features (NX-Bit, SSE2)
- Keine offiziellen Updates mehr für viele Distributionen ab 2025
- Eingeschränkte Multimedia-Funktionalität
Empfehlung:
Für die meisten Anwender ist Linux auf 32-Bit-Hardware eine übergangslösung mit folgenden Empfehlungen:
- Nutzen Sie spezialisierte Distributionen wie AntiX oder Q4OS
- Vermeiden Sie internetexponierte Dienste (keine Server)
- Planen Sie mittelfristig ein Hardware-Upgrade
- Nutzen Sie das System für spezifische Aufgaben:
- Retro-Gaming (DOSBox, ScummVM)
- Dokumentenarchivierung
- Lokale Medienwiedergabe
- Programmieren lernen (C, Python, Bash)
- Erstellen Sie regelmäßige Backups (die Hardware kann jederzeit ausfallen)
Letztlich bietet Linux für 32-Bit-Systeme eine zweite Chance – nicht als Dauerlösung, aber als Möglichkeit, alte Hardware sinnvoll zu nutzen, während man sich auf modernere Systeme vorbereitet.